Data Breach Summary
Form Energy, Inc., along with its subsidiaries Form Factory 1, LLC, and Form Energy Works, LLC, has recently informed individuals that their personal information may have been involved in a cybersecurity incident. The breach was caused by a ransomware attack, and the company has since taken action to investigate and address the issue. To mitigate the potential impact of the breach, Form Energy is offering complimentary credit monitoring and identity theft protection services to those affected.
On September 16, 2025, Form Energy became aware of a ransomware attack on its systems. In response, the company took immediate steps to secure affected systems by taking them offline and engaging external cybersecurity experts to assist with the investigation. Forensic analysis revealed that one of the compromised machines contained historical employee personal information, dating back to team members who worked at the company as of, and prior to, September 2023.
Through their investigation, Form Energy identified that various types of personal information were potentially exposed, including sensitive data such as names, addresses, dates of birth, Social Security numbers, bank account numbers, I-9 verification documents (such as driver’s licenses, permanent resident cards, alien registration cards, or passports), and beneficiary information. Form Energy has indicated that there is no direct evidence of misuse of the personal data at this time. However, out of an abundance of caution, the company has taken steps to inform affected individuals and provide resources to help protect their information.
In addition to notifying those affected, Form Energy is offering a complimentary 24-month membership in Experian IdentityWorksSM, which includes credit monitoring and identity theft protection services. This service also provides fully managed identity theft recovery services should you need assistance in the future.
